## Deployment

Fabrikit, our test-data factory library, ships as a versioned package consumed by the Quillhaven staging jobs. Support does not deploy Fabrikit directly; it is pulled at pipeline start. To bump the version, update the lockfile in the seed-jobs repo and rerun the nightly build. Rollbacks are just a lockfile revert. If seeded records look wrong, check the generator seed first. The active deployment configuration is shown below.

deployment values, bahof-badug:
[rusix]
team = zorok
access_code = ac_641cbe
owner = ulair.tamius
host = rusix.torvasoft.local
port = 5672
peer = ulaix.sivrelworks.internal
salt = 1df570ed
pin = 6327

Runbook: Slow template rendering in Lanternworks Portal. If render times exceed 400ms, check the partial cache hit rate first; cold caches after a deploy are the usual cause. Warm the cache with the seed script before paging anyone. If latency persists past two warm cycles, capture a render profile and attach it to the incident channel. Reference the trace below when filing.

session token of tajef-bageg = htk21_5d90d574934f3ccae6437

Subject: Scheduled key rotation for the Inkfold invoice renderer

Hello plugin authors,

On the first of next month we are rotating credentials for the Inkfold PDF rendering service. Plugins using the old key will receive 401 responses after the cutover. Please update your configuration ahead of time. The replacement key for the rendering endpoint follows below.

API key for yahig-tadup: kto7_ubizbYm

### Audit item 14 — GC pauses in Matchloom

Status: amber. The Matchloom matching service is still seeing occasional 600ms+ garbage-collection pauses during peak pairing windows, which trips the latency SLO about twice a week. The heap-tuning experiment helped but didn't fully close the gap, and the arena-allocation spike from the new scoring cache is a suspect. Next step is a flame-graph session before Friday. For status updates at the sync, check in with the person named below.

account owner for fajep-yagef: Kasix Eliiel